How much simple interest is earned on $4,558.35 at an interest rate of 3.2% in 9 years?

Respuesta :

jamuuj jamuuj
  • 01-03-2019

Answer:

=$ 1,312.80

Step-by-step explanation:

Simple interest is given by the formula  PRT/100

Where P is the principal amount, R is the interest rate and T is the interest period in years.

= ($ 4,558.35 × 3.2 ×9)/100

=$ 1,312.80
